Jump to content
Notícia
  • News ticker sample
  • News ticker sample

carolhcs

Membro
  • Content Count

    32
  • Joined

  • Last visited

  • WCoins

    0 [ Donate ]

Community Reputation

0

1 Follower

About carolhcs

  • Rank
    WebCheats
  • Birthday 10/27/1992
  1. http://www.webcheats.com.br/forum/programacao-duvidas-ajuda/2440817-duvida-sobre-recursao-post9165825.html#post9165825
  2. Olá a todos, tenho a seguinte duvida: Como eu faço uma função recursiva que permita somar os dígitos de um numero inteiro dado como entrada, por exemplo se a entrada é 123, a saída deve ser (1+2+3) = 6 Obrigada
  3. Meu...:coracao: Obrigada...quase chorei de emoção a hora que compilou...obrigada mesmo *-* Salvou minha vida TNX !!! (Obs: eu até pensei por um segundo em fazer o que vc fez, mas como o professor ainda não explicou bem isso, achei que não tinha nada a vê '-') Obrigada Resolvido ^^
  4. Olá pessoal, preciso de ajuda, recebi o seguinte problema: :triste: Uma empresa decidiu fazer um levantamento sobre o perfil dos candidatos para vagas de emprego. Inicialmente o programa deve solicitar a digitação da quantidade de candidatos participantes da pesquisa. O programa deverá ler, para cada candidato, a idade, o **** (M ou F) e a experiência no serviço (S ou N). O programa deve calcular e mostrar: • Número de candidatos do **** feminino • Número de candidatos do **** masculino • Idade média dos homens • Número de mulheres com idade inferior a 21 anos e com experiência no serviço • Porcentagem dos homens com mais de 30 anos entre o total dos homens Fis o seguinte programa, que não esta compilando: #include <stdio.h> void main() { int x, y; float id, fem=0, masc=0, idmedia=0, mq=0, id2=0, porc=0, soma=0; char op, sex; printf("\nDigite o numero de candidatos participantes da pesquisa:\n"); scanf("%i", &y); for(x=1; x<= y ; x=x+1){ printf("\nInforme Sua Idade: \n"); scanf("%f", &id); printf("\nInforme Seu ****: \n"); printf("M-Masculino e F-Feminino\n"); scanf("%c", &sex); printf("\nVoce tem experiencia no servico? \n"); printf("S-Sim e N-Não\n"); scanf("%c", &op); if (sex == 'f' || sex == 'F'){ fem = fem + 1; } if (sex == 'm' || sex == 'M'){ masc = masc + 1; soma = soma + id; idmedia = soma / masc; if(id > 30){ id2 = id2 + 1; } } if (sex == 'f' || sex == 'F' && id < 21 && op == 's' || op == 'S'){ mq = mq + 1; } } printf("\nParticiparam da pesquisa:\n"); printf("\n %.0f Mulheres\n", fem); print(" %.0f Homens\n", masc); printf("A idade media dos Homens foi: %.0f\n", idmedia); printf("O Numero de mulheres com idade inferior a 21 anos e com experiencia no servico foi: %.0f\n", mq); porc = (id2/masc)*100; printf("A porcentagem dos homens com mais de 30 anos entre o total dos homens foi: %.0f%%\n", porc); system("PAUSE"); } Uso o Compilador Dev C, aguardo respostas, obrigada =^.^=
  5. Aff nem acredito --' realmente era meu calculo valew gente :corado: O calculo correto: P1 = SAL * 0.2; :o :star:
  6. Tópico Fechado Motivo: Dúvida Solucionada A dúvida do autor já foi resolvida, e para manter a organização da área o tópico será fechado. Obrigado a todos que responderam tal dúvida de forma útil. Atenciosamente, Equipe Web Cheats! -------------------------------------------------------------------------------------------- Ola olha eu aqui de novo, bom indo direto ao assunto, tava criando um programinha para apresentar em um trabalho da faculdade, o programa é bem simples, ele calcula os gastos das pessoas e fala se ela gasta muito ou economiza bem e tal, ai fiz ele bonitinho, ele compilou e tal, mas to com um problema que pesquisei, tentei varias coisas e não consigo resolver, provavelmente o programa se encontra na parte do if e else, pois de acordo com a conta, se o resultado for baixo ele deve mostrar o primeiro texto, se for intermediário o segundo e se for bom o ultimo, eis que surge o problema, eu executei e testei os valores para ver as frases, só que não importa o que eu coloque, o resultado é sempre o mesmo, sempre o ultimo, por favor me ajudem a arrumar isso, obrigada e até logo :chorando: //Programa exemplo v1.0 //CarolHCS //1º Sem. ADS #include <stdio.h> #include <stdlib.h> #include <string.h> #include <conio.h> int main(void) { int G1, G2, G3, G4, G5, G6, G7, SAL, GT, DS, P1, P3; printf("Informe seu Salario:"); scanf("%d", &SAL); printf("Agora informe seus gastos mensais com:\n"); printf("\nMoradia:"); scanf("%d", &G1); printf("\nAlimentacao:"); scanf("%d", &G2); printf("\nSaude:"); scanf("%d", &G3); printf("\nTransporte:"); scanf("%d", &G4); printf("\nEducacao:"); scanf("%d", &G5); printf("\nLazer:"); scanf("%d", &G6); printf("\nOutros:"); scanf("%d", &G7); GT = G1 + G2 + G3 + G4 + G5 + G6 + G7; DS = SAL - GT; printf("\n\nSeu Salario: %d", SAL); printf("\n\nSeus Gastos totais: %d", GT); printf("\n\nSua Economia mensal: %d", DS); P1 = (5/100) - SAL; P3 = (25/100) - SAL; if (DS <= P1) printf("\n\nInfelismente seu percentual de economia esta muito baixo\n\nProcure uma forma de diminuir os gastos em areas menos importantes, como:\nLazer e Outros\n\nE muito importante termos um dinheiro extra para emergencias ou outras nescessidades\n\nBoa Sorte com suas economias\n\n\n"); else if ((DS > P1) && (DS <= P3)) printf("\n\nIntermediario..."); else if (DS > P3) printf("\n\nParabens...\n\n\n"); system("PAUSE"); return(0); } @Edit Percebi que minha ultima conta estava errada e mudei ficando assim: P1 = SAL - (5/100); P3 = SAL - (25/100); Ai testei, só que agora só aparece a primeira frase =[ deu na mesma, aguardando ajuda!!!
  7. Poderia visitar este tópico referente à estrutura de programação com linguagem Java? -> http://www.webcheats.com.br/forum/outras-linguagens/2189482-estruturando-melhor-aplicativos-com-ui-user-interface.html Sei que é chato pedidos de "veja meu tópico" mas gostaria de saber se o senhor se interessa por tópicos do tipo.
  8. sumiu, rs. Anda programando?
  9. Entendi =D por isso não importa o que eu faça ou o que use sempre to limpando tudo abaixo do menu, sempre, vlw d novo xD, vou fazer meus últimos ajustes, compila e imprimi... Obrigada por os dois me ajudarem...Vou imprimir uma apostila de C...¬¬' to precisando =D :smiley:
  10. '-' como assim tudo? eu rodei aki e o menu ta sempre aparecendo =[
  11. :aplauso: Aleluia... acho q entendi alguma coisa, vou ver o que consigo... vlw xD :yes:
  12. Só achei um probleminha, na hora de apagar o que digitei aparece uns caracteres ao invés de apagar, mas tudo bem, tá ótimo assim, ajudou muito =P Muito obrigada, resolvidoo *-* :yes: @Edit Obs: Se puder corrigir o erro acima agradeço, se não, não faz mal =^.^=
  13. Vlw Gostei muito do menu, o único problema na parte de Manter o programa aberto e fazer ele voltar ao inicio, e adicionar a opção de saída e forçar a saída é que não consigo aplicar ao código, já pesquisei e achei mil e uma maneiras, mas na hora de colocar no código e por para rodar, nunca funciona, por isso preciso que seja mais especifico e esclarecedor, sou muito iniciante msm em C, e é difícil de entender algumas coisas e como usá-las, agradeço muito quem puder ajudar,me mostrando onde e como usar os códigos...:suando:
  14. O seguinte tópico foi movido para a área correta, assim você poderá ser ajudado de forma adequada e segura, e também estará evitando tumultos e confusões, peço que se certifique em que área tal conteúdo está sendo postado para saber mais sobre as regras dê uma consultada nas mesmas. Regras: http://www.webcheats.com.br/forum/anuncios/921806-regras.html Tópico Movido: http://www.webcheats.com.br/forum/programacao-duvidas-ajuda/2126434-ajuda-com-programinha-em-c.html Atenciosamente Equipe Web Cheats.
  15. tem msn/skype? Manda por mensagem.
×
×
  • Create New...